     This state capital has a unique collection of Civil War-era battle flags (Union). I was told of a fascinating man, and possible future paper topic for me, named Richard Gil Forester. Mr. Forester was a free-black from the state of Virginia. When VA succeeded from the Union, they threw the US flag that was flying on their State House on the ground. Mr. Forester, seeing this as a horror, picked it up and kept in safe. It, along with flags from every other Union state, are kept in display boxes in the entrance of the New Hampshire State Capital. I was very moved by it and would encourage anyone who has a chance to see it to do so.
